Technical Analysis

From a technical standpoint, TIGO is currently trading between two well-defined near-term price levels: a support level of $76.35 and a resistance level of $84.39. The $76.35 support level has acted as a reliable floor for the stock in recent weeks, with each pullback to that price point drawing consistent buying interest from technical traders, preventing further downside moves. On the upside, the $84.39 resistance level has acted as a firm near-term ceiling, with selling pressure emerging each time TIGO has tested that level in recent sessions, leading to pullbacks back towards the middle of the current trading range.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is currently in neutral territory, showing no signs of extreme overbought or oversold conditions that could signal an imminent sharp move in either direction. TIGO is also trading slightly above its short-term moving average and roughly in line with its medium-term moving average, indicating a lack of strong directional momentum in the near term, as buyers and sellers remain roughly balanced at current price levels. Outlook

Looking ahead, traders will likely be watching the two key technical levels closely for signs of a potential breakout or breakdown. If TIGO were to break above the $84.39 resistance level on higher-than-average volume, that could potentially signal a shift in near-term sentiment, possibly leading to further upside price action as technical traders enter positions to follow the breakout. Conversely, if the stock were to fall below the $76.35 support level, that might indicate that near-term buying interest has weakened, potentially leading to further downside moves in the coming sessions. Broader sector trends, including updates around telecom regulatory policy in TIGO’s core operating markets and shifts in global risk sentiment for emerging market assets, could also influence the stock’s trajectory in upcoming weeks, potentially helping to push the stock outside of its current range. Market participants note that absent any upcoming company-specific fundamental announcements, technical levels are likely to remain the primary driver of TIGO’s near-term price action.
